Output 660ae5e66df92b38011bd826c3cef8fa1f827f21287369b593aedcd991c30f80:21

value
166561
script pubkey
OP_0 OP_PUSHBYTES_20 e342c493fdac5212888f8027a68195789e7252de
address
bc1qudpvfyla43fp9zy0sqn6dqv40z08y5k7l7wzq9
transaction
660ae5e66df92b38011bd826c3cef8fa1f827f21287369b593aedcd991c30f80